pub struct Entry<'a, K, V> {
    ssomap: &'a mut SsoHashMap<K, V>,
    key: K,
}
Expand description

A view into a single entry in a map.

Implementations§

source§

impl<'a, K: Eq + Hash, V> Entry<'a, K, V>

source

pub fn and_modify<F>(self, f: F) -> Self
where F: FnOnce(&mut V),

Provides in-place mutable access to an occupied entry before any potential inserts into the map.

source

pub fn or_insert(self, value: V) -> &'a mut V

Ensures a value is in the entry by inserting the default if empty, and returns a mutable reference to the value in the entry.

source

pub fn or_insert_with<F: FnOnce() -> V>(self, default: F) -> &'a mut V

Ensures a value is in the entry by inserting the result of the default function if empty, and returns a mutable reference to the value in the entry.

source

pub fn key(&self) -> &K

Returns a reference to this entry’s key.

source§

impl<'a, K: Eq + Hash, V: Default> Entry<'a, K, V>

source

pub fn or_default(self) -> &'a mut V

Ensures a value is in the entry by inserting the default value if empty, and returns a mutable reference to the value in the entry.
